Mobile LIBRARY

The Mobile Library is at the Village Hall car park between 1200 and 1220 every third Thursday.

The next visit will be on  Thursday 19th October.

The Local HOUSEHOLD WASTE RECYCLING CENTRE is at Hill Quarry, Dulcote, near Wells (tel 01749 670973) It is designed for householders to take extra refuse and items that cannot be put out for collection. They are open every day except Christmas Day and New years day.

Opening Times: Summer (April - September) 8am-8pm, Winter (October - March) 8am - 5pm
